Output a04bf7116a8d9fe6ec99ebce91adbc963b25bb5341981192095d570718fd9f76:3

value
19800022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ffcef7aeff6a0794ee9b2a3c2937dff2fda13d76 OP_EQUAL
address
3R1cApFZDLfCGRhCgAVnnQHt8ziRt9A83s
transaction
a04bf7116a8d9fe6ec99ebce91adbc963b25bb5341981192095d570718fd9f76
confirmations
345912
spent
true